Te Wharekura o Nga Purapura o Te Aroha

A state composite (years 1–13) in Goodfellow Park, Te Awamutu, with 94 students on its Jul 2026 roll.

These add up to more than the roll. The Ministry records ethnicity as total response: a student who identifies with more than one ethnicity is counted in each. Percentages are each group's share of the 94 students on the roll, so they sum to about 116%, not 100%.

What EQI measures

The Equity Index estimates the extent to which a school's students face socio-economic barriers to achievement. It describes the community a school serves — it does not measure school quality, teaching, or student outcomes. A school facing more barriers can be an outstanding school. Who may enrol

Te Wharekura o Nga Purapura o Te Aroha does not operate an enrolment scheme. There is no home zone, and enrolment is not restricted by where a student lives. How enrolment zones work →
